Table of Contents

Introduction: New Media Technologies, Social Media, Millennials, and Generation Z: An Introduction Ahmet Atay and Mary Z. Ashlock Section 1: Social Media in Everyday Life Chapter 1: Strike a Po(z)e!: Generation Z’s Engagement with Fashion Brands on Social Media Sophie Nightingale and Cristina Miguel Chapter 2: Millennials/Gen Z, Dating Applications and Tinder: Living on Social Network Sites and Searching for Love and Community Ahmet Atay Chapter 3: Everything is an App (Including Us): The Media Ecology of Generation Z Brian Gilchrist Chapter 4: Millennials and the Gen Z in the Era of Social Media Anca Serbanescu Section 2: Millennials and Generation Z in Different Contexts Chapter 5: Welcoming Gen Z to the Workforce: Leveraging Digital Literacy for Recruitment and Retention Stephanie Smith and Michael Strawser Chapter 6: Observations in the Classroom: Bridging the Gaps among Media, Technology, and College Students Mary Z. Ashlock, Yi Jasmine Wang, Lindsay J. Della, Siobhan E. Smith-Jones, and Ralph S. Merkel Chapter 7: The Representations of Generation M and Z in the Mass Media: A Texting Mining Analysis Kenneth C. C. Yang and Yowei Kang Section 3: Global Examples Chapter 8: The Role of Technological Change in Facilitating Young People’s Experiences with Computer-Mediated Communication (CMC) in the United Kingdom Lauren Dempsey Chapter 9: Media and Technology: Generational Differences and Attitude of Nigerian Media Users in Nigeria Oluwafunmilayo ‘Bode Alakija and Anthony Amedu Chapter 10: Digital Children of the Digital Era: A Case Study of Generation Z on Instagram H. Hale Künüçen and Leyla Akbaş About the Contributors
